Your New Role As a seasonal, full-time Park Ranger Assistant, you will assist year-round State Park staff with the protection, maintenance, and operation of park lands, resources, facilities, and equipment. In this position, you will typically handle basic tasks in a variety of disciplines including janitorial services, landscaping and trail work, facility maintenance, and visitor services. Basic skills in building trades, such as carpentry, plumbing, and electrical work, may be needed. Specialized skills in park maintenance could also be required. You may also guide volunteers or other staff in completing specific tasks. We recruit for seasonal positions each year that generally work June through September; however, the duration may vary depending on the park's specific needs.
